How long have you been taking the ritalin? What doses have you tried? Did the Dr. start small and ramp you up or just start at 40mg? Im also assuming this is extended release as 40mg instant release is high, espicially to start out with. There is no right dosage. everyone is different. The side effects wear off as your body gets used to the drug. I was taking concerta(same drug, different name and release form) and after a few months i was sure i wanted to try soomething else. I tried adderall and have been a happy camper since. www.addforums.com is an excellent source of info.

lol...thats not why the military doesn't take ADHD people who have medicated. The military considers ADHD an ongoing medical condition and they don't want individuals who are dependent on or may need psychological drugs to function that they have to supply. However, if you are diagnosed after you are in, then you can remain in.
